Deer killed by dog in Richmond Park, police say
Met Police are appealing for help identifying the owner of a dog believed to have killed a deer in Richmond Park.
Officers said a deer was fatally attacked at about 12:30 GMT on 2 December.
"It is illegal to allow dogs to chase deer," the force said on X.
"Dog walkers must ensure their pets are under close control at all times and if there is any doubt about their temperament or recall ability, then keep them on a lead."
